“…Since 2011, a variety of plasmids have been found to be associated with the NDM gene, such as the incompatibility (Inc) groups IncF, IncA/C, IncL/M, or even on the bacterial chromosome [ 15 ]. In Brazil, the bla NDM gene was also observed in plasmids with different sizes [ 16 ], indicating that this resistance determinant occurs in different mobile genetic element backbones [ 11 ].…”
